Well I use a MacBook OS X ..
There is only a CD writer, and DVD reader, but is it possible to change it to a DVD writer?

Just get an external burner. The only way to change it is to take the whole thing apart which will void your warranty and is quite difficult.

On the other hand, if it's already out of warranty, why not? You'd just have to get a slimline, slot-loading DVD burner and remove the faceplate before installing.
